The Language of the Web:

JavaScript is the backbone of interactive web development. It allows developers to enhance static HTML pages with dynamic content, responsive designs, and interactive user experiences. With JavaScript, you can manipulate the Document Object Model (DOM), enabling real-time updates, form validation, animations, and much more. It empowers developers to build modern, engaging websites that cater to users' expectations and needs.

Versatility and Platform Independence:

One of JavaScript's most significant advantages is its versatility. Originally developed for web browsers, JavaScript has expanded its reach beyond the web. With Node.js, JavaScript can now be used for server-side development, allowing developers to build scalable and efficient web applications. Furthermore, frameworks like React Native and Ionic enable JavaScript to be used for cross-platform mobile app development, streamlining the development process and reducing code duplication.

Ecosystem and Community:

JavaScript boasts a vast ecosystem of libraries, frameworks, and tools that cater to various development needs. Popular frameworks like Angular, React, and Vue.js simplify complex UI development, while libraries like jQuery and Lodash offer utility functions and simplified DOM manipulation. Additionally, the npm package manager provides access to countless open-source packages, enabling developers to leverage the collective knowledge and expertise of the JavaScript community.

Modern JavaScript Features:

Over the years, JavaScript has undergone significant improvements and introduced modern language features. ES6 (ECMAScript 2015) brought enhancements like arrow functions, template literals, classes, and modules, making code more concise and readable. Subsequent versions of ECMAScript have continued to enhance the language with features like async/await, destructuring, spread syntax, and more. These additions have further increased JavaScript's appeal, making it a pleasure to write and maintain code.


Asynchronous Programming:

JavaScript's asynchronous programming model is a game-changer for handling tasks that involve waiting for resources or external events. With features like callbacks, promises, and async/await, developers can write non-blocking code that can efficiently handle multiple tasks simultaneously. This is particularly crucial for tasks such as making API calls, performing database operations, or handling user interactions in real-time. Asynchronous programming in JavaScript enhances performance, responsiveness, and overall user experience.

Continuous Evolution:

JavaScript continues to evolve rapidly, with new features and improvements being introduced regularly. ECMAScript proposals, such as optional chaining, nullish coalescing operator, and private class fields, provide glimpses into the future of the language and demonstrate a commitment to addressing developer needs. This constant evolution ensures that JavaScript remains relevant and capable of meeting the demands of modern software development.

Full-stack Development:

JavaScript's versatility extends beyond the client and server domains. With frameworks like MEAN (MongoDB, Express.js, Angular, Node.js) and MERN (MongoDB, Express.js, React, Node.js), developers can build end-to-end web applications using JavaScript throughout the entire stack. This full-stack capability reduces the learning curve, facilitates code sharing, and promotes seamless integration between different components of an application.

Progressive Web Applications (PWAs):

JavaScript plays a crucial role in the development of Progressive Web Applications (PWAs). PWAs combine the best of web and mobile app experiences, offering features like offline functionality, push notifications, and device hardware access. With JavaScript, developers can build PWAs that are platform-independent, accessible, and responsive, providing users with a native app-like experience .
